Advertisement

Thomas Blackwood Strachan

Advertisement

Thomas Blackwood Strachan

Birth
Virginia, USA
Death
23 Sep 1892 (aged 23)
Virginia, USA
Burial
Screamersville, Chesterfield County, Virginia, USA Add to Map
Memorial ID
View Source